This side event, aligned with the priority theme of the 63rd session of the Commission for Social Development, on strengthening solidarity, social inclusion, and social cohesion, focuses on discussing the intersection of AI and social equity through an intergenerational lens.Â
Organized by the UN DESA Programmes on Youth and Ageing, it aims to foster dialogue among experts and advocates to examine how AI can be leveraged to address the potential risks of AI-driven inequality that affect both future youth and older persons, ensuring that technological advancements contribute to social cohesion and equitable development for all generations.
This event also aligns with the current focus of the ECOSOC presidency on ethically harnessing artificial intelligence to drive progress on sustainable development.
